Overview
Huawei nova 11 SE is a mid-range Android smartphone released in 2023 with a 6.67-inch OLED, Snapdragon 680 chipset, 108 main camera, and 4500 mAh battery.
Priced at $416, it targets users seeking mid-range performance.
Specifications of Huawei nova 11 SE
The display of Huawei nova 11 SE measures 6.67 inches with OLED technology and 90Hz refresh rate. Peak brightness reaches 800 nits for excellent outdoor visibility. The screen renders at 1080x2400 pixels resolution.
The camera system of Huawei nova 11 SE features 3 rear cameras: 108 main, 8MP ultrawide. Video recording supports up to 1080p.
The battery of Huawei nova 11 SE has 4500mAh capacity with 66 wired charging. A full charge takes approximately 32 min minutes.
The performance of Huawei nova 11 SE is powered by the Snapdragon 680 chipset with Adreno 610 GPU. Geekbench scores reach 410 single-core and 1500 multi-core. AnTuTu benchmark achieves 255000.
The memory of Huawei nova 11 SE offers 8GB RAM with 256GB storage options. RAM uses LPDDR4X technology. Storage is UFS 2.1. Storage is not expandable.
The connectivity of Huawei nova 11 SE includes 5G support, Wi-Fi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, and Bluetooth 5.0. NFC is supported for contactless payments.
The build of Huawei nova 11 SE weighs 186g with Aluminum frame and Glass back. Dimensions measure 162.4 x 75.5 x 7.4 mm.
The software of Huawei nova 11 SE runs HarmonyOS 4.0 with EMUI. Software support extends 3 years through 2029.
